Summary |
"Now in full color, Clinical Manifestations and Assessment of Respiratory Disease, Sixth Edition bridges normal physiology and pathophysiology to provide a solid foundation in recognizing and assessing respiratory diseases and disorders. Authors Terry Des Jardins and Dr. George G. Burton describe how to systematically gather clinical data, formulate an assessment, make an objective evaluation, identify the desired outcome, and design a safe and effective treatment plan, while documenting each step along the way. Unique coverage of Therapist-Driven Protocols (TOPs) prepares you to implement industry-approved standards of care."--Book jacket |
